I was using Page Maker, it does not work anymore with windows 10 , which product could replace it ?

Adobe Page maker does not work with Windows 10 , I have a lot of note cards and/or greeting cards done with it . Is it a adobe or other brand product which I could use without having to rebuild all af them ???

Adobe InDesign is the replacement for PageMaker.

And as a former longtime PageMaker user, I will tell you now that you will love it, and wondered why you waited to switch.

Buy Adobe InDesign CC | Download desktop publishing software free trial

But read these threads. When I switched over, I rebuilt my files from scratch.

Jacques, I was also a long-time Pagemaker user (from 1.0, on), and made the transition to Adobe Indesign shortly after it became available. The transition was smooth, and Indesign has continued to become more efficient, easy to use with each version. I agree with BarbBinder, who also provided the helpful links for you.
